For someone who never seems to have enough time to eat, let alone cook, I have to say this is a great recipe. It's quick, it's delicious, and I had all the ingredients just laying around. I did add artichoke and parmesan as well, and I used a tiny bit of mayonnaise because the sandwich looked a little dry. As it turns out, it really wasn't as dry as it looked, but the mayo was a good addition.

I took these sandwiches to my sisters bridal shower and they were a hit. I followed the recipe just like it is and the only thing I would recommend is to either serve them immediately or heat them in the microwave right before you serve them. When I served them they were pretty cold and it changed the sandwich a little. Overall though they were wonderful and full of flavor.

I made this with fresh asparagus that I simmered for a few minutes in salted boiling water, and then sliced in half. The cheese and bacon was, of course, delicious, but I didn't think the asparagus was a good addition. It was also pretty unwieldy to eat. I'm glad I tried it, but I wouldn't make it again.
